 Here are 5 ways to make money offline at home, along with a brief description of each:

 

1. Crafts and handmade products: Create and sell crafts or handmade products at local markets or through consignment in stores. Use your creativity to make unique items like jewelry, artwork, or home decor that appeal to customers.

 

2. Freelance services: Offer your skills and services locally, such as graphic design, photography, or home repairs. Advertise your services in your community or through word-of-mouth referrals to attract clients who need your expertise.

 

3. Pet sitting or dog walking: Take care of pets or offer dog walking services in your neighborhood. Many pet owners are in need of reliable and trustworthy individuals to look after their furry friends while they are away or busy.

 

4. Tutoring: Provide in-person tutoring services for students in your area. Offer assistance in subjects you excel in, such as math, science, or languages. Advertise your tutoring services through local schools, community centers, or online platforms.

 

5. Event planning: Help plan and organize events, such as weddings or parties, for clients. Use your organizational and creative skills to coordinate venues, decorations, catering, and other aspects of the event. Network with local vendors and build a reputation for delivering memorable events.

 

These offline ways to make money at home allow you to leverage your skills, creativity, and local connections to generate income without relying on the internet.

 

Here's a description of each of the 25 ways to make money online, offline, and at home:

 

Online:

 

1. Freelancing: Offer your skills and services on platforms like Upwork, Freelancer, or Fiverr. You can provide services such as writing, graphic design, programming, virtual assistance, and more. Clients post projects, and you can bid on them or showcase your portfolio to attract clients.

 

2. E-commerce: Start your own online store using platforms like Shopify or WooCommerce. Sell physical products, digital downloads, or even dropship products from suppliers. You can create your own brand, set up a website, and handle product listings, inventory management, and customer orders.

 

3. Affiliate marketing: Promote products or services and earn a commission for each sale made through your referral links. Join affiliate programs on platforms like Amazon Associates, ClickBank, or ShareASale. You can promote products through your website, blog, social media, or email marketing.

 

4. Online tutoring: Teach subjects you excel in through online tutoring platforms like Tutor.com or Chegg. Help students with academic subjects, test preparation, or language learning. You can conduct one-on-one sessions or group classes through video conferencing.

 

5. Content creation: Create engaging content on platforms like YouTube, TikTok, or Instagram and monetize through ads, sponsorships, or brand deals. Build a loyal audience and provide value through your content. You can earn money based on views, ad clicks, or collaborations with brands.

 

6. Online surveys and market research: Participate in online surveys or market research studies on websites like Swagbucks or Survey Junkie. Earn rewards or cash for sharing your opinions and feedback. These platforms connect you with companies looking for consumer insights.

 

7. Blogging: Start a blog and monetize it through ads, sponsored content, or affiliate marketing. Write about topics you are passionate about and attract an audience through valuable and engaging content. You can earn money through ad networks, sponsored posts, or promoting products as an affiliate.

 

8. Online course creation: Share your expertise by creating and selling online courses on platforms like Udemy or Teachable. Teach others valuable skills or knowledge in your niche. You can create video lessons, quizzes, and assignments and earn money when students enroll in your course.

 

9. Social media management: Help businesses manage their social media presence and create engaging content for their platforms. Offer services like content creation, scheduling, and community management. You can work with multiple clients and help them grow their online presence.

 

10. Stock trading and investing: Learn about stock trading and investing through online platforms like Robinhood or TD Ameritrade. Invest in stocks, bonds, or other financial instruments to grow your wealth. You can buy and sell securities based on market trends and analysis.

 

11. Virtual assistant: Provide administrative support to individuals or businesses remotely as a virtual assistant. Assist with tasks like email management, scheduling, data entry, or customer support. You can work with clients on a freelance basis or join virtual assistant agencies.

 

12. Online transcription: Transcribe audio or video files for clients through platforms like Rev or TranscribeMe. Listen to recordings and convert them into written text. Accuracy and attention to detail are important for this type of work.

 

13. Graphic design: Offer your graphic design skills to create logos, banners, or social media graphics for clients. Use design software like Adobe Photoshop or Canva to create visually appealing designs. You can work on projects for individuals or businesses.

 

14. Web development: Build and design websites for clients using your web development skills. Create responsive and user-friendly websites using programming languages like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. You can work on projects ranging from simple websites to complex web applications.

 

15. Online language teaching: Teach a language you are fluent in through platforms like italki or Verbling. Conduct language lessons through video calls and help students improve their language skills. You can set your own rates and schedule.

 

16. Podcasting: Start your own podcast and monetize through sponsorships, ads, or listener donations. Choose a niche or topic you're passionate about and create regular episodes. As your podcast grows in popularity, you can attract sponsors or earn money through ads.

 

17. App development: Develop and sell mobile apps or offer app development services to clients. Create apps for iOS or Android devices based on client requirements. You can work on your own app ideas or collaborate with businesses to create custom apps.

 

18. Virtual events and webinars: Organize and host virtual events or webinars on topics of interest and charge attendees for access. Share your knowledge or invite guest speakers to provide valuable insights. Platforms like Zoom or WebinarJam can help you host and monetize these events.

 

19. Influencer marketing: Build a strong social media presence and collaborate with brands as an influencer to promote their products or services. Create engaging content and grow your followers. Brands may pay you for sponsored posts, product reviews, or brand endorsements.
